Bosnian utility RiTE Gacko faces EUR 128.1mn in lawsuits - report.

By bne IntelliNews June 7, 2011
The potential costs that Bosnian coal mine and power plant complex Gacko (RiTE Gacko) might incur from filed lawsuits against it have reached KM 250.5mn (EUR 121.1mn) as at end-December 2010, newswire biznis.ba reported, quoting an audit report. These claims include a KM 115.4mn lawsuit by Czech energy company CEZ against Bosnian utility Elektroprivreda RS and RiTE Gacko with which it has established a joint venture for the failed project for extension of Gacko with the construction of a thermoelectric power plant. Some KM 113.6mn represent claims of investment funds, which are minority shareholders at RiTE Gacko. Another KM 15.2mn come from interest on late payments. These lawsuits have not been settled before the finalisation of the audit report. RiTE Gacko's net profit widened seven-fold to KM 2.1mn in 2010 from KM 0.3mn in 2009.
